Meu eclipse não reconhece a JVM em minha máquina

Baixei a versão do Eclipse Helios(JEE) e o glassfish. Instalei o GlassFish(Já incluso o SDK). Se eu rodo o IBM Rational, ele funciona bem. Porem se rodo o Eclipse, ele nem starta, pois dá o erro de que não existe JVM instalada no computador. Alguém saberia me dizer se existe este negócio de incompatibilidade?(Glassfish e Eclipse).

Você pode acertar o eclipse.ini para que aponte para o diretório certo onde está o JDK.

Esse é o meu INI. Como eu faço isso?

[code]-startup
plugins/org.eclipse.equinox.launcher_1.1.0.v20100507.jar

–launcher.library
plugins/org.eclipse.equinox.launcher.win32.win32.x86_1.1.1.R36x_v20100810
-product
org.eclipse.epp.package.jee.product

–launcher.defaultAction
openFile

–launcher.XXMaxPermSize
256M
-showsplash
org.eclipse.platform

–launcher.XXMaxPermSize
256m

–launcher.defaultAction
openFile
-vmargs
-Dosgi.requiredJavaVersion=1.5
-Xms40m
-Xmx512m[/code]

http://wiki.eclipse.org/FAQ_How_do_I_run_Eclipse%3F#eclipse.ini